After the first few questions I panicked and thought there was no way I was going to pass, they were ambiguously worded or had very similar answer options. Only had 4 mins left on the timer and gave myself less than 50/50 but passed with above target in all areas!

I used the Head First Agile book which i completed cover to cover in about 10 weeks plus re-reading some sections. I recommend it, it aims for you to understand the topics and has lots of activities and puzzles to drive the info in the brain.
I listened to most of the prepcasts starting about a month ago but I underestimated how many episodes there are and didnt get through them all.

The Exam Simulator was invaluable and made all the difference. I spent 11 hours and 14 minutes on it in total.
The first exam i got 61% then 70%, 68% and 78% so i wasn't fully confident.
The questions mostly matched the real exam, although i found the real exam less clear.
I used the learning quizzes to back on questions i answered incorrectly multiple times and made lots of notes.
In the last two mock exams i made a note of which answers i changed after going back to marked questions. On both exams i changed correct to incorrect answers more often than incorrect to correct so i decided on the real exam to only change if i was certain.

The test centre in Sydney was tatty and noisy so thanks for the tip on the prepcast to take earplugs! There were NC headphones there.
